About N-[5-[4-fluoro-3-(4-piperidin-1-yl-1H-imidazo[4,5-c]pyridin-2-yl)-1H-indazol-5-yl]-3-pyridinyl]-3-methylbutanamide

N-[5-[4-fluoro-3-(4-piperidin-1-yl-1H-imidazo[4,5-c]pyridin-2-yl)-1H-indazol-5-yl]-3-pyridinyl]-3-methylbutanamide (PubChem CID 136936497) has the molecular formula C28H29FN8O and a molecular weight of 512.59 g/mol. Its IUPAC name is N-[5-[4-fluoro-3-(4-piperidin-1-yl-1H-imidazo[4,5-c]pyridin-2-yl)-1H-indazol-5-yl]-3-pyridinyl]-3-methylbutanamide.
